Transaction f81abcf69d7679648e7d4aa80583f9ffc73ded97f77b585d49694aac49aae996
1 Input
1 Output
-
f81abcf69d7679648e7d4aa80583f9ffc73ded97f77b585d49694aac49aae996:0
- value
- 74998338
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4ad02d62e39eb85aca0fe8d8f57324bb7a82e5016deeecdca256c41a5846aef2
- address
- bc1pftgz6chrn6u94js0arv02ueyhdag9egpdhhweh9z2mzp5kzx4meqxtnhdn